2Eyes Vision S.L, founded in 2015 and based in Madrid, Spain, specializes in developing technology for visual diagnostics and corrections. The company has created SimVis, a proprietary visual simulation technology specifically designed for multifocal lens applications in presbyopia and cataract surgery. This technology allows patients to experience real-world vision prior to undergoing surgical procedures, addressing the challenge faced by surgeons in selecting the most suitable intraocular lenses from a vast array of options available in the market. The SimVis Gekko device, which has received FDA clearance and CE marking, is portable and user-friendly, enhancing patient satisfaction and assisting ophthalmologists in making informed decisions about lens selection. With over 2 billion people globally affected by presbyopia and cataracts, and an aging population contributing to increased surgical options, 2Eyes Vision aims to improve clinical practices and patient outcomes in the field of ophthalmology.

ANYVERSE is a high-confidence synthetic datasets production technology intended for next-generation perception systems, raging from AV/ADAS to UAV and smart cameras. They aim to make the training and testing of autonomous systems cost-effective, faster, and more precise. ANYVERSE employs a proprietary render engine with photometric-accurate light simulation to produce a reliable output. Its software solutions give users full control over sensor specs, scenario dynamics, and variability.

LeanXcale is a converged SQL database, combining Ultra-Scalable capabilities and full ACID transactional consistency of distributed data. Its innovation is based on a radically new approach to transactional processing enabling it to provide transactional data consistency while scaling out to large numbers of nodes. LeanXcale is a HTAP (Hybrid Transaction/Analytical Processing) database purpose built to provide enterprise class OLTP while fulfilling the needs of the most demanding OLAP users. Combining operational and analytical information in one database is the next logical evolution in data management providing instant access to analytics on important business moment. This is easily achievable while increasing business flexibility and agility while reducing total cost of ownership.

UAV Navigation is a privately-owned company specialized in the design of flight control systems and motion processing modules. Its flight control solutions are used by a variety of tier 1 aerospace manufacturers in a wide range of Remotely Piloted Aircraft Systems, also known as Unmanned Aerial Vehicles or 'drones'. These include high-performance tactical unmanned planes, aerial targets, mini-UAVs, helicopters, and multi-copters. In addition, UAV Navigation leverages its technology for other innovative products and solutions, including sporting goods, inertial aviation, automotive telemetry, motor and air racing, and consumer electronics. The cornerstone of the company’s success is a comprehensive, in-house capability to develop Attitude and Heading Reference Systems, flight control algorithms, and to fuse the data provided by multiple sensors. Its staff consists of a multinational team of specialists with backgrounds as diverse as aerospace, microelectronics, aeronautical engineering, and military defense technology that brings motion processing technology to new markets. Founded in 2004, UAV Navigation is an ISO9001-certified company with a worldwide distributor network. It is located at San Sebastián De Los Reyes.
KDPOF is a Madrid-based company specializing in high-capacity communication technology using Large Core Plastic Optical Fiber (POF). The company develops advanced systems that include digital integrated circuits designed for robust optical networking, particularly suited for harsh environments and long-reach communications. KDPOF's products are characterized by their inherent galvanic isolation, lightweight design, and cost-effectiveness. These features enable home and small office/home office (SOHO) networks, as well as clients in the automotive and industrial sectors, to achieve optical gigabit connectivity tailored to their specific needs. Through its innovative approach, KDPOF aims to enhance the efficiency and adaptability of POF communication technology, leveraging the latest advancements in digital communications and information theory.

Netspira Networks develops software tools and applications for the management of added-value services in the data networks of mobile telephone operators. Founded in 2001, it is based in Madrid, Spain.
